Started life as an Audi Coupe 2.6E and I have massively modified it. It has some more traditional type of modifications such as:
• Koni Suspension (Shocks and springs lowered by about 30mm)
• Poly bushes throughout and aluminium subframe bushes
• 18 inch OZ Alloys
• I also have the original wheels with very good tyres, two of which are winter tyres. They are my winter wheels.
• Very high spec ICE system, includes Alpine 6*9 up front and 4inch pioneer TS’s at the read with a Alpine bass box in the boot and one of the best Alpine head units you can get IMO.
• Brake servo conversion from Hydraulic assist to Vacuum assist.
• Black diamond front disk and EBC yellow stuff pads all round.
• S2 ellipsoid headlamps
• Taxed until End of July
• MOTed till Feb 2013.
And then we have the specialised stuff, I basically fitted an Audi A4 2.8 30v (Quad cam, VVT) engine with completely new wiring loom and a S2 custom dials with plasma illumination. The engine is controlled via Syvec’s ECU, one of the best ECU’s on the market. Here is the list:
• Engine – 2.8 30 valve rebuilt heads 5000 miles ago.
• Aluminium flywheel with S2 hybrid clutch
• Syvec’s ECU with custom loom, running closed loop lamba and closed loop knock control.
• AEM AFR stepper motor gauge.
• Custom stainless steel exhaust with Sebring back box.
• Apexi pod intake.
• Cusco catch tank.
• SARD fuel pressure regulator.
• Bosch 044 fuel pump in tank.
It is putting out just over 200 hp ATM, my plans were always to install a PES G2 supercharger and with all the existing mods it would just need a remap and should give 300 hp.
